Sismindari is a scholar working on Molecular Biology, Animal Science and Zoology and Food Science. According to data from OpenAlex, Sismindari has authored 42 papers receiving a total of 547 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 19 papers in Molecular Biology, 9 papers in Animal Science and Zoology and 8 papers in Food Science. Recurrent topics in Sismindari's work include Identification and Quantification in Food (11 papers), Meat and Animal Product Quality (9 papers) and Plant Genetic and Mutation Studies (6 papers). Sismindari is often cited by papers focused on Identification and Quantification in Food (11 papers), Meat and Animal Product Quality (9 papers) and Plant Genetic and Mutation Studies (6 papers). Sismindari collaborates with scholars based in Indonesia, Malaysia and India. Sismindari's co-authors include Abdul Rohman, Yuny Erwanto, Yaakob B. Che Man, Kuwat Trıyana, Sudjadi, Tri Joko Raharjo, Sugiyono Sugiyono, Endang Semiarti, Adam Hermawan and Rumiyati Rumiyati and has published in prestigious journals such as S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ología, Meat Science and International Journal of Food Properties.
